What Does Hail Damaged Roof Damage Look Like?

Spotting hail damage isn’t always a walk in the park, but there are some telltale signs you can’t miss. Here’s what to keep an eye out for:

Bruising on Shingles –

Run your hand across the shingles. Feel soft spots? That’s bruising from hail hits, and it can weaken your roof over time.

Cracked Shingles –

Sometimes, hail leaves cracks that mess up the waterproofing. This can lead to sneaky leaks down the road.

Granule Loss –

Check your gutters or downspouts for a pile of granules. Hail knocks them off, exposing your roof to UV damage.

Dents on Metal Surfaces –

Gutters, vents, or flashing with small dents? Hail was here. These dents might look minor but can cause problems later.

Missing Shingles or Tiles –

Big chunks of hail can loosen or completely knock off shingles. Scary stuff, right?

Property damage –

Look for cracks or dents in light fixtures, lawn furniture, garage doors, pool equipment, or mailboxes—these can point to roof damage.

Indoor water issues –

Water stains, discoloration, puddles, mold, or damp insulation inside your home could mean hail has harmed your roof. As a result, it allows water to seep in.

Factors Causing Roofing Hail Damage

When hail hits, the damage can vary greatly and several key factors determine the extent. Here’s what you need to know:

Wind Patterns:

The speed, strength and direction of the wind during the hail storm determines where hail hits and how hard it hits. Stronger winds can drive hail with more force and more damage.

Hailstone Size:

Not all hailstones are created equal. Smaller hailstones might cause minimal damage, larger ones can dent, crack or break roofing material altogether.

Roofing Material:

Different roofs react differently to hail. Asphalt shingles dent or crack, metal roofing shows dents. What’s on your roof matters.

Density and Shape of Hailstones:

Some hailstones are compact and solid, with more impact; others are lighter and less damaging. Sharp or jagged hailstones can carve or pierce your shingles and leave them exposed.

Natural Barriers:

Overhead protection like trees or surrounding structures can act as a shield and reduce the damage to your roof. This extra layer of protection might be the difference between minor and major issues.

How Much Does Hail Damage Roof Repair Cost?

We understand that hail damage home repair costs can be a major concern for homeowners. While the cost of this service varies depending on the extent of the damage, some averages can help you get an idea.

Minor Damage:

In most cases, minor roof repairs from hail damage start at around $200.

Moderate Damage:

If your home has moderate roof damage that requires partial shingle or tile replacement or patching, expect to pay up to $1,000.

Severe Damage:

For severe roof damage that needs extensive replacement or repairs, prepare yourself for costs upwards of $10,000 or more.
